#5557f2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5557f2 is composed of 33.3% red, 34.1%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.9% cyan, 64%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 239.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 64.1%. #5557f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#aaaeff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#5557f2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010c is the darkest color, while #f9f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5557f2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a2a5 is the less saturated color, while #4e50f9 is the most saturated one.
